Creating a Supportive Environment

The first step towards finding health solutions at an urgent psychiatric center is creating a supportive environment that fosters healing and growth. This includes a warm, welcoming atmosphere that encourages patients to open up and share their struggles without fear of judgment or stigma.

Moreover, a supportive environment emphasizes the importance of building strong connections between patients and their care team. This means promoting communication, empathy, and understanding between all parties involved in a patient’s treatment process.

Skilled Professionals

The success of any psychiatric center depends largely on the skill of its professionals. At an urgent psychiatric center, patients must have access to highly trained healthcare providers who specialize in mental health. This includes psychiatrists, psychologists, therapists, and other mental health professionals who are equipped with the knowledge, skills, and experience to address a wide range of mental health concerns.

Additionally, skilled professionals must be able to work with patients to find personalized treatment solutions that meet their specific needs. This requires a patient-centered approach that values individualized care over a one-size-fits-all approach.

Collaborative Efforts

Finding health solutions at an urgent psychiatric center requires a collaborative effort between patients, their loved ones, and their care team. Engaging in collaborative efforts means working together to achieve a common goal: mental wellness.

For example, patients must be active participants in their treatment plans, taking ownership of their mental health and working alongside their care team to find viable solutions. Loved ones can also play a vital supportive role by fostering a positive environment at home and encouraging patients to continue with treatment plans.
